Desert Ant Labs

Desert Ant Labs

Freemium

A library of small, task-specific on-device AI models for speech, text and vision, dropped into any app with one native SDK.

Key features

  • Voz On-Device Speech Recognition: Transcribes roughly ten minutes of audio in two seconds on an iPhone, with no audio ever leaving the device.
  • Clear Speech Enhancement: Cleans up noisy recordings to studio-quality sound locally, removing the need for a cloud audio-processing bill.
  • Redact PII Filtering: Detects and removes personally identifiable information from text on the device, so sensitive data never transits a server.
  • Align Word Timestamps: Produces accurate word-level timestamps for any transcript, enabling precise captioning and clip trimming.
  • Uhm and Clips Video Editing Models: Finds and removes every filler word and automatically selects highlight segments for short-form video.
  • Unified Native SDK: One SDK for Swift, Kotlin and JavaScript drops any model into an app in a few lines of code, with weights also published on Hugging Face.
  • Text Understanding Suite: Gist generates topics and tags, Title suggests titles and descriptions, Tongue identifies a language from three words, and Emo suggests emoji.
  • Vision and Moderation Models: Shapes turns rough sketches into perfect shapes, while Moderator flags nudity before an image is uploaded or displayed.

Best for

  • Offline Transcription in Mobile Apps: Add dictation, voice notes or meeting capture to an iOS or Android app that keeps working with no network connection.
  • Privacy-Sensitive Data Handling: Strip PII from user-submitted text or audio before it is ever stored or sent upstream, simplifying compliance.
  • Short-Form Video Automation: Auto-select highlight clips, cut filler words and burn in accurate word-timed captions inside a consumer video editor.
  • Cost Control at Consumer Scale: Ship AI features to millions of users without metering tokens, because inference runs on the user's hardware instead of a paid API.
  • Content Moderation Before Upload: Screen images for nudity and text for hate speech on-device so unsafe content is blocked before it reaches a backend.
  • Sketching and Diagram Tools: Use shape recognition to snap freehand drawings into clean geometry inside a notes or whiteboard product.
  • Multilingual Routing: Detect the spoken or written language of incoming content locally, then route it to the right downstream workflow.
